In Renormalization Group MD (RGMD) performed using atomic-cluster-based particles, Inverse Renormalized MD (IRMD) is carried out on specified occasions to observe atomic motion in clusters. Then, on the begining of the IRMD, it is necessary to determine initial positions and velocities of atoms in clusters such that physical and/or mechanical coditions of clusters are consistent with those of member atoms.
